英文摘要
Protective immunity requires interaction between the acquired and the innate immune systems.
While great advances have been made towards understanding the critical role of the acquired
immune system in the defense against HIV infection, our knowledge of the role of innate immunity
is rather limited. The Gl mucosal immune system plays a vital role in protection against infection by
HIV and opportunistic pathogens, in part through mucosal secretions, containing a rich variety of
soluble innate immune mediators. We hypothesize 1) that differences identified in the susceptibility
of mucosal infection by HIV (oral vs. rectal and vaginal) are a result of differences in the types and
concentrations of soluble innate immune mediators in their secretions, 2) that the increased risk
of development of Gl opportunistic infections with immunosupression are a result of decreased
secretion of innate immune mediators by the mucosa, 3) that immunosuppression is also associated
with wholesale changes in the mucosal microbiota, 4) that alterations in the local microbiota contribute
to alteration in the secretion of soluble mediators of innate immunity, and 4) that increased mucosal
colonization by proinflammatory bacterial species will result in secretion of mediators that stimulate
mucosal HIV replication. We therefore propose to 1) to test the hypothesis that HIV nfection is
associated with depressed mucosal secretion of soluble innate immune mediators, 2) to test the
hypothesis that HIV-induced immunosupression, through its effects on secretion of innate immune
proteins, results in changes in the diversity of the mucosal microbiota throughout several Gl mucosal
sites, and 3) to test the hypothesis that alterations of the mucosal microbiota alter secretion of
immune mediators, which in turn affect HIV replication in the Gl mucosa. The knowledge gained
from the proposed studies may lead to mechanisms to suppress HIV replication, alter the natural
history of HIV disease and decrease the susceptibility of mucosal sites to HIV infection.
